Space Work is Important
If you’re an improviser, you know how important it is to maintain some sort of reality when you’re on stage. Whether that’s holding a gun properly (no pointing fingers!) to putting on clothes to answering a phone, the way you do these everyday actions go a long way in helping propel scenes forward in a truthful manner.
The following video, “How to Spot an Improviser,” from CBesRun makes fun of space work. I thought you’d enjoy it.
The guy doing the phone bit is totally doing the space work weird. You only answer the phone with devil horns if hell is calling.
